Nutritional Overview

Russet potatoes are a starchy vegetable rich in fiber, potassium, and vitamin C. They provide complex carbohydrates for sustained energy and are a good source of vitamin B6, which supports brain function and metabolism. Russet potatoes also contain magnesium and antioxidants that contribute to overall health. While often associated with high-calorie dishes, they can be a healthy choice when baked or roasted with minimal added fat.
